I've spoken to several people at a firm and they have all given me contact information to recruiters.
Can someone please provide some advice on what would be the best approach to contacting them and what to write in the emails? I'm also not sure if I should first apply and then send them an email, or first reach out expressing interest in the firm?
Any advice would be greatly appreciated.
Reach out saying X referred you. Restate your strong interest for the firm. Ask a question or two about the analyst program. You'll most likely get an interview especially with several people referring you to HR.
